The complete second series of the historical comedy set just before the American Revolution.
Andy Hamilton and Jay Tarses’ script for Revolting People, about the American War of Independence, winningly mixes the ‘boom boom’ school of jokes, literary silliness (jeopardy means ‘like a jeopard’) and anachronisms which make deft political points.
Hamilton and Tarses, who has written for the Muppets and the Bob Newhart Show, appear alongside Jan Ravens (Deadringers) and James Fleet in an unmissable series with appearences from Hugh Dennis and Michael Fenton Stevens (TWOS).
